dc.description.abstractThis project focuses on designing and simulating a secure Internet Service Provider (ISP) network using Cisco Packet Tracer, with an emphasis on layer 3 switching, VLAN segmentation, and Proper security configurations. The network was built using Cisco layer 3 switches, and Firewalls to ensure that the network is robust, scalable and secure. Key configurations include VLAN Trunking, Access Control Lists, DHCP setup, OSPF Configuration(for internal communication), BGP Configuration( for communication with the IIG network) and port security to mitigate common threats such as unauthorized access, spoofing, and DDOS attacks. The simulation successfully demonstrated a functional ISP network with proper traffic management redundancy and security policies. This project serves as a practical reference for implementing secure enterprise-grade networks using Cisco technologies.
